SunPower Announces New Solar Panel Manufacturing Facility

August 08, 2011 by Jeff Shepard

SunPower Corp. announced plans to own and operate a solar panel manufacturing facility in Mexicali, Mexico to meet the demand of a growing North American solar market.

SunPower plans to lease an existing building, which has up to 320,000 square feet of capacity. Today’s announcement is consistent with SunPower’s strategy to expand its upstream vertical integration for local panel manufacturing. SunPower will manufacture its high-efficiency E18 series, E19 series and world record setting E20 series solar panels for residential, commercial and power plant projects, and will also produce its SunPower® T5 Solar Roof Tile system.

"Establishing our own manufacturing facility in Mexicali means we will be positioned to quickly deliver our high-efficiency, high-reliability solar products to a growing North American solar market," said Marty Neese, SunPower’s Chief Operating Officer. "Over the past year, we have successfully ramped up manufacturing at Fab 3 in Malaysia where we set records for output and yield efficiency. SunPower also launched manufacturing in California, with a facility in Silicon Valley, and expanded our panel manufacturing in Europe."
